Landscaping Modification in Ventura County, CA
Landscaping modification services involve altering existing outdoor spaces to improve functionality, aesthetics, or both. These projects can include reshaping lawns, adding or removing features such as pathways, patios, or retaining walls, and updating plant arrangements to better suit the property's needs. Homeowners typically seek these modifications to enhance curb appeal, create more usable outdoor areas, or address drainage and soil stability issues. Before requesting services, property owners should consider their specific goals for the space, any existing features they wish to retain or change, and any relevant property restrictions or permits required for certain modifications.
Understanding the scope of landscaping modification projects is important for homeowners to ensure their expectations align with the work involved. Common requests include redesigning yard layouts, upgrading existing landscape features, or making adjustments to improve privacy or accessibility. Property owners should also be aware of the current condition of their outdoor spaces, including soil quality, existing structures, and plant health, to facilitate effective planning. Clear communication of desired outcomes and any budget considerations can help ensure the modification process meets the property owner’s needs.

Common Landscaping Modification Jobs
Garden Bed Revisions - reshaping and updating existing planting areas for better aesthetics and functionality.
Lawn Area Modifications - adjusting lawn sizes or shapes to optimize space and improve curb appeal.
Pathway and Walkway Changes - altering or adding walkways to enhance accessibility and visual flow.
Hardscape Adjustments - modifying patios, decks, or retaining walls to suit new landscape designs.
Tree and Shrub Revisions - pruning, relocating, or removing plants to better fit the landscape plan.
Drainage and Grading Changes - improving water flow and preventing erosion through landscape modifications.
